Pokémon Tower Defense

Release date : Mar 30, 2011 ( 12 years ago )

When a pack of wild Rattata attack Professor Oak's lab, it is up to you to stop them. Set out on your own Pokémon journey, to catch and train all Pokémon and try to solve the mystery behind these attacks. Featuring the original 151 Pokémon!

Quick Links

© Rubigames. All Rights Reserved.